The Hosts
WorldSkills Germany is a non-governmental organiaztion that has been given the mandate by the Federal Government to send the German national team to WorldSkills and EuroSkills. As a member of the international WorldSkills network, the organization, which was founded in 2006, is an ambassador for Germany as an educational and business location. Germany itself has been a member of WorldSkills International since 1953. Currently, WorldSkills Germany unites the commitment and ideas of over 90 members, partners, companies, and associations.
